public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{ var allUsers = Roles.AllUsers; if (allUsers != null) { // Документы. InitializationLogger.Debug("Init: Grant rights on documents to all users."); GrantRightsOnDocuments(allUsers); // Справочники. InitializationLogger.Debug("Init: Grant rights on databooks to all users."); GrantRightsOnDatabooks(allUsers); } // Назначить права роли "Руководители проектов". InitializationLogger.Debug("Init: Grant rights on projects"); GrantRightsOnProjects(); CreateDocumentTypes(); CreateDocumentKinds(); CreateProjectKinds(); CreateProjectFolder(); GrantReadRightsOnProjectDocuments(); GrantReadRightsOnProjectTeam(); CreateDefaultApprovalRoles(); CreateDefaultApprovalRules(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{ CreateDefaultDueDiligenceWebsites(); CreateDistributionListCounterparty(); UpdateBanksFromCBR(); CreateCounterpartyIndices(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{ CreateRole("Руководитель юр. отдела", "Руководитель юр. отдела, роль с одним участником", Constants.Module.Initialize.FinanceArchiveGuid); GrantRightsOnFolder(); // Создать типы документов для договоров. CreateDocumentTypes(); // Функция инициализации для выдачи прав на "Проектные документы". RevokeRightsToObjects(); GrantRights(); Docs(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{ var allUsers = Roles.AllUsers; if (allUsers != null) { Logger.Debug("Init: Grant right on shell special folders to all users."); GrantRightOnFolders(allUsers); } }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{ CreateReportsTables(); GrantRightsToResponsibilitiesReport(); CreateSorageProcedures(); InitializationLogger.Debug("Init: Create visibility settings."); CreateVisibilitySettings(); CreateIndecies(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{ // Создание ролей. InitializationLogger.Debug("Init: Create roles."); CreateRoles(); // Выдача прав роли "Ответственные за совещания". InitializationLogger.Debug("Init: Grant right on financial documents for responsible."); GrantRightToMeetingResponsible(); CreateDocumentTypes(); CreateDocumentKinds(); CreateDocumentRegistersAndSettings(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{ // Создание ролей. InitializationLogger.Debug("Init: Create roles."); CreateRoles(); // Выдача прав роли "Ответственные за финансовый архив". InitializationLogger.Debug("Init: Grant right on financial documents for responsible."); GrantRightToFinancialResponsible(); CreateDocumentTypes(); CreateDocumentKinds(); CreateFinancialDocumentRegistersAndSettings(); CreateDefaultFinancialApprovalRules(); CreateReportsTables(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{ // Создание ролей. InitializationLogger.Debug("Init: Create roles."); CreateRoles(); // Справочники. InitializationLogger.Debug("Init: Grant rights on databooks to all users."); GrantRightsOnDatabooks(); // Создание типов прав модуля. InitializationLogger.Debug("Init: Create access rights."); CreateCounterpartyAccessRights(); CreateExchangeServices(); InitializeExchangeServiceUsersRole(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{ var allUsers = Roles.AllUsers; if (allUsers != null) { // Справочники. InitializationLogger.Debug("Init: Grant rights on databooks to all users."); GrantRightsOnDatabooks(allUsers); // Документы. InitializationLogger.Debug("Init: Grant rights on documents to all users."); GrantRightsOnDocuments(allUsers); GrantRightOnFolders(allUsers); } // Создание ролей. InitializationLogger.Debug("Init: Create roles."); CreateRoles(); // Довыдача прав роли "Ответственные за настройку регистрации". InitializationLogger.Debug("Init: Grant right on registration for registration managers."); GrantRightToRegistrationManagersRole(); // Выдача прав роли "Ответственные за договоры". InitializationLogger.Debug("Init: Grant right on contract documents for contracts responsible."); GrantRightToContractsResponsible(); // Выдача прав роли "Регистраторы договоров". InitializationLogger.Debug("Init: Grant right on contract documents for registration contractual documents."); GrantRightToRegistrationContractsRole(); CreateDocumentTypes(); CreateDocumentKinds(); CreateDefaultApprovalRoles(); CreateDefaultRelationTypes(); CreateDefaultContractualRules(); CreateDocumentRegisterAndSettingsForContracts(); CreateEDocIndex(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{ // Создание ролей. InitializationLogger.Debug("Init: Create roles."); CreateRoles(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{ GrantRigthsToExternalEntityLinks(); CreateExternalEntityLinksIndexes(); CreateCountryRegionsCitiesFromFIAS(); }
public override void Initializing(Sungero.Domain.ModuleInitializingEventArgs e) { }